FISHER™ V280

Technical Parameters Parameter Specification Model Fisher V280 Vee-Ball Valve Type Severe Service Rotary V-Notch Ball Control Valve Flow Characteristic Equal Percentage Shut-Off Class ANSI Class VI (Bubble-tight) with standard non-metallic seats. End Connections Flanged (ANSI Class 150 & 300) Body Materials Carbon Steel (WCB), Stainless Steel (CF8, CF8M) Ball Material Stainless Steel with Hardened Coatings (e.g., chromium carbide) available for extreme abrasion. Stem Material Stainless Steel Seat Material Reinforced PTFE (RPTFE), Ultra-High Molecular Weight Polyethylene (UHMW-PE) Temperature Range -40°F to 400°F (-40°C to 204°C) with standard polymeric seats. Pressure Rating ANSI Class 150: 275 psig (19 bar) ANSI Class 300: 720 psig (49.6 bar) Flow Capacity (Cv) Varies by size. Example (Class 150 Flanged, 8"): Cv ~ 2050 Sizes (Pipe Size) 3" to 16" (DN 80 to DN 400)

The Fisher V280 is a heavy-duty, flanged V-notch ball control valve engineered for severe service applications involving abrasive slurries, viscous fluids, and fibrous suspensions. It builds upon the standard V-ball design with enhanced materials and construction to deliver maximum longevity and reliability in the most demanding environments.
